The world of business is rapidly evolving, and with it, the demand for professionals skilled in Systems, Applications and Products (SAP) is on the rise. SAP is a leading provider of business software solutions that streamline processes across various industries. As businesses continue to leverage this technology to enhance their operations, the demand for SAP professionals continues to grow. This article explores three paths you can take to launch your career in SAP and secure rewarding SAP jobs.
The first step towards securing SAP jobs is acquiring the right education and training. A bachelor's degree in computer science, information systems, or a related field provides a solid foundation for a career in SAP. However, having a degree alone may not be enough; specialised training in SAP is crucial.
SAP offers various training programs through its SAP Learning Hub. These programs cover different modules such as finance, human resources, supply chain management, customer relationship management among others. By taking these courses, you gain an understanding of how different business processes are integrated and managed using SAP software.
In addition to formal education and training, it's essential to stay updated with the latest trends and developments in the field of SAP. You can do this by attending webinars, workshops, seminars or joining online forums dedicated to SAP.
Like any other job market, experience plays a critical role when it comes to securing lucrative SAP jobs. Most employers prefer candidates who have hands-on experience with various aspects of SAP.
One way to gain relevant work experience is by starting out in entry-level positions such as an IT support specialist or data analyst within organisations that use SAP software. These roles provide opportunities for learning about different functionalities of the software while also gaining practical experience.
Another way is through internships or co-op programs offered by companies that use or implement SAP solutions. These programs provide a platform for learning and applying SAP skills in a real-world business environment.
SAP certification is a surefire way to stand out in the competitive job market. It validates your expertise and proficiency in handling specific SAP modules or components.
SAP offers different levels of certification, from associate to professional level, across various modules. The associate level certification is ideal for beginners and covers the fundamental knowledge of SAP solutions, while the professional level is designed for those with deep understanding and proven project experience.
Obtaining an SAP certification not only enhances your credibility but also increases your chances of landing high-paying SAP jobs. However, it's important to note that getting certified requires a significant investment of time and resources, so it's crucial to choose a certification that aligns with your career goals.
